The problem is that these are not really frames. They are extra PNG images placed behind the actual image. The image file is animated but the frame image is not. These kind of "frames" really have no place in modern web design where we can use CSS to create effects and cut out the extra PNGs that slow the web page download time. They should certainly never be used on the mobile version of the site. Here's an example of a widget which creates a box shadow and a bottom drop shadow using CSS.
